THE WORLD IS VERY BUSY

The world is very busy, men are traveling to and fro.
Their souls are very restless - they are always on the go.
There's a spirit of oppression, depression and despair
Hovering above them - here there and everywhere.
Tho knowledge is increasing, there is much less sense;
For wisdom is the lacking, and intelligence.
How heavy is the feeling that these are man's last days,
And heavy is the spirit, filling hearts with dismay.

But cheer-up friend and listen.  You need not fear this doom.
There is a new world coming, and it will be here soon.
A world of joy and laughter, of love and peace and rest,
And eternal living, safe within God's best.
There'll be no night or shadows, anxieties or fears,
Hearts will not be troubled, nor eyes filled with tears.
Our homes will all be mansions, Heaven's glory we will gain.
Built, prepared and readied, by the Lamb for sinners slain.

A life of grace and glory.  A new life without end.
Are waiting there before you,
Won't you walk with me my friend?
We are waiting at the cross-roads,
There are two roads in sight.
One will lead to heaven,
The other to endless night.
Narrow is the right road,
Christ paved to heaven's gain;
But wide and short the wrong road,
That leads to hell's domain.
